Scrutinizing the nexus between green innovations and the sustainability of environmental system: novel insights from European database.

Abstract

A study is presented in this paper that examines the effect of environmental innovation (EI) on environmental performance (EP). Six measures are used to reflect environmental innovation, including the percentage of enterprises that invest in environmental innovation, the percentage of enterprises implementing environmental innovation activities, the number of ISO 14001 certificates, patents related to environmental innovation, the total R&D personnel and researchers, and the amount of green early-stage investments. The estimation results show that EI positively impacts EP in 21 European countries using different econometric techniques during the 2011-2019 period. By using various econometric techniques (namely a panel-corrected standard errors (PCSE) model, a feasible generalized least square estimates (FGLS) model, and the two-step general method of moment (the two-step GMM), our research demonstrates how environmental innovation impacts on environmental quality. The short- and long-term effects of autoregressive distributed lag (ARDL) methods were also investigated using pooled mean groups (PMGs) to distinguish the short-run and long-run influences of EI. The relationship between EI and EP is explored by demonstrating how EI affects EP short- and long-term and comparing its influence on EP across many component measures of EI: air quality, sanitation, drinking water, heavy metals, waste management, biodiversity, habitat, ecosystem services, water resources, and agriculture. Notably, we find that the influences of EI become more pronounced in a country characterized by a well-developed institutional system. Our findings suggest policy implications to help countries invest in research and development with concerns about environmental damage mitigations more effectively. These findings are critical to suggest a way to help countries pursue ecological sustainability.

摘要

本文研究了环境创新(EI)对环境绩效(EP)的影响。采用了六项指标来反映环境创新,包括企业环境创新投资比例、企业实施环境创新活动比例、ISO14001 证书数量、与环境创新相关的专利、环境创新研发人员总数和研发人员数量以及绿色早期投资金额。估计结果表明,在 2011 年至 2019 年期间,使用不同的计量经济学技术,21 个欧洲国家的 EI 对 EP 具有积极影响。通过使用各种计量经济学技术(即面板校正标准误差(PCSE)模型、可行广义最小二乘估计(FGLS)模型和两步广义矩方法(两步 GMM)),我们的研究展示了环境创新如何影响环境质量。还使用了自回归分布滞后(ARDL)方法的短期和长期效应,使用均值组(PMG)进行了 pooled mean groups(PMGs),以区分 EI 的短期和长期影响。通过展示 EI 如何影响 EP 的短期和长期以及比较 EI 对 EP 的影响在许多组成部分指标上:空气质量、卫生、饮用水、重金属、废物管理、生物多样性、生境、生态系统服务、水资源和农业,来研究 EI 与 EP 之间的关系。值得注意的是,我们发现,在制度体系发达的国家,EI 的影响更加显著。我们的研究结果为帮助各国更有效地投资于对环境破坏的缓解研究和发展提供了政策建议。这些发现对于建议帮助各国追求生态可持续性的方法至关重要。
